Chromium mediated synthesis of 4-iodo-1-triisopropylsilylindole followed by 4-methoxycarbonyl-methylthiation by palladium catalysed cross coupling with methoxycarbonylmethylthio(trialkyl)-stannane and aldol condensation gave the key α-thioacrylate intermediate 5. The Z-geometry of the major isomer of 5 was determined by X-ray crystal analysis. Closure of ring C by a novel fluoride ion catalysed formation of the 2a–3 bond completed a short synthesis of (±)-chuangxinmycin methyl ester 1(R = Me).
